Completely Renovated Modern Farm house meets Mid-Century Modern. 1 Block from "The Most Beautiful Townsquare in Texas." The whole group will be comfortable in this spacious and unique space. There are 4 bedrooms and 3 bathrooms. This house has a spacious living room and kitchen and a great outdoor space to keep your entire party occupied. You will be within walking distance to live music, upscale restaurants, bars, Southwestern University and a 5 minute drive to Georgetown Lake. 20 minutes to the Formula1 Track

The pros: The house itself was as pictured, although a bit more rustic than we had thought. House was easily accessible and well-appointed. Reasonably clean.
The cons: At least one of the bedroom doors would not close all the way. The biggest con was that the front door “smart” lock kept automatically unlocking one night. We ended up taking the batteries out so that it would stay locked. I notified the property manager and we agreed that she would have the door fixed after our stay since it was not an emergency. One day while we were out, however, the owner came into the house without our knowledge and fixed the door. He was at minimum in the front room and kitchen; who knows where else. It was quite unnerving to return to find that our space had been entered without agreeing to this- this is against policy. The property manager apologized but frankly, that doesn’t seem quite enough. I didn’t hear a thing from the owner, despite he being the perpetrator of this invasion of privacy/ breach of contract. In summary, I wouldn’t seek out his vrbo again due to the fact that the owner came into the home without our knowledge. This was a new property on vrbo and perhaps the owner doesn’t know the rules, but I wouldn’t risk being in that situation again considering we had small children in our group.
